GRÚAS SÁEZ, S.L., the „Seller“, guarantees the new cranes purchased by the Buyer, under the terms and conditions detailed below, hereinafter referred to as the „Terms“, which regulate the rights and obligations of the parties in relation to the guarantee, compliance with which is a requirement for its validity.
1 . PURPOSE AND SCOPE OF THE WARRANTY
1.1. The Seller guarantees to the Buyer that the new crane purchased by the Buyer is in perfect working order and is therefore free from any defects in materials and workmanship and in optimum working condition, in accordance with the agreed technical specifications.
1.2 The guarantee is limited exclusively to the repair or replacement, at the Seller’s choice, of those parts of the crane which, during the guarantee period, prove to be defective due to faults in materials or workmanship, provided that the crane is used and maintained in accordance with the manufacturer’s instructions. All other costs arising from the replacement of the parts covered by this warranty shall be borne by the Buyer.
1.3 Therefore, costs related to transportation, disassembly, assembly or other expenses not approved in writing by the Seller are expressly excluded from coverage under this warranty; however, the Seller may, at their option, reimburse reasonable shipping and labour costs incurred for previously authorised repairs, always in writing, after individualised evaluation.
2 . WARRANTY PERIOD.
a) Twelve (12) months from the date of receipt by the Seller of the „Crane Commissioning Check List“ document, duly completed by the Buyer. This document should be sent to warranty@gruassaez.raanet.es within a maximum period of two (2) months from the invoice date of the crane. If not received in time, the guarantee shall be deemed to have started automatically on the date of the sales invoice, but shall not become effective until the aforementioned document is presented.
b) The use of the crane for a total of two thousand four hundred (2,400) hours of operation, according to the equipment log.
3. CONDITIONS FOR THE APPLICATION OF THE WARRANTY.The validity of the warranty shall be subject to the Buyer’s compliance with the following conditions:
a) Strictly comply with the „Warranty Technical Assistance Procedure“ in force.
b) Submit the „Crane Commissioning Check List“ within the time limit stipulated in section 2.1 point a).
c) Notify the Seller in writing of any defect or malfunction within seven (7) days of discovery, and always within the
warranty period.
d) Allow repairs or replacements to be carried out only by personnel authorised by the Seller.
e) Ensure that the crane has been operated and maintained in accordance with the manual provided by the Seller.
4. WARRANTY EXCLUSIONS. The warranty shall not apply in the following cases:
a) Natural wear and tear resulting from ordinary use of the crane, including but not limited to seals, gaskets, hoses, wire
ropes, filters and external coatings.
b) Repairs, modifications or alterations to cranes carried out by personnel outside the GRÚAS SÁEZ, S.L. organisation, without authorisation from the latter.
c) Misuse, neglect or non-compliance with the Seller’s operating and maintenance instructions.
d) Operation in extreme weather or geographical conditions without prior written authorisation from the Seller.
e) Alterations in the quality of the electricity supply.
f) Force majeure events, such as fire, flood, vandalism or natural disasters.
g) Use of the crane after a defect or breakdown has been detected without notifying the Seller.
h) Improper storage or prolonged exposure to weathering.
i) Damage caused during transport or by the carrier.
5. LIMITATION OF LIABILITY
The Seller shall not be liable to the Buyer or any third party for any indirect, incidental, consequential, or punitive damages, nor shall the Buyer be liable under this warranty for any loss of profits, business interruption, damage to property or claims from any third party. The Seller’s maximum liability under this warranty shall be limited to the value of the defective part which is the subject of the claim. This warranty is in lieu of and excludes all other warranties, express or implied, including those of merchantability or fitness for a particular purpose, which are expressly excluded to the fullest extent permitted by law.
6. ASSIGNMENT
This warranty is personal and non-transferable and applies only to the original Buyer and the Buyer’s position under this warranty may not be assigned to any third party without the prior written consent of the Seller. Any such attempted transfer or assignment without such authorisation shall be null and void.
7. T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E PROCEDURE
This procedure is known to the Buyer, as it is available to them in the crane maintenance book received with the crane,
and the Buyer must scrupulously comply with its contents for any procedure based on this warranty.
